#bd5eda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d5eda is composed of 74.1% red, 36.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 286 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 61.2%. #bd5eda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bcff with #7b00b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#bd5eda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bd5eda has RGB values of R:189, G:94,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12410586.

Hex triplet bd5eda #bd5eda
RGB Decimal 189, 94, 218 rgb(189,94,218)
RGB Percent 74.1, 36.9, 85.5 rgb(74.1%,36.9%,85.5%)
CMYK 13, 57, 0, 15
HSL 286°, 62.6, 61.2 hsl(286,62.6%,61.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 286°, 56.9, 85.5
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 55.975, 56.946, -47.655
XYZ 37.642, 23.888, 68.954
xyY 0.288, 0.183, 23.888
CIE-LCH 55.975, 74.255, 320.076
CIE-LUV 55.975, 37.793, -81.279
Hunter-Lab 48.875, 51.946, -49.435
Binary 10111101, 01011110, 11011010

Shades and Tints of #bd5eda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d5eda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9b9d is the less saturated color, while #cd40f8 is the most saturated one.
